CAMBRIDGE, Mass. - The Colby-Sawyer women's rugby 7's team began its first varsity spring season with four matches at the Crimson 7's tournament hosted by Harvard University.
The Chargers will return to the pitch on Saturday, April 13 for a 7's tournament hosted by Sacred Heart.
COLBY-SAWYER vs. HARVARD - L, 7-46
The Chargers received a try from
Bailey Burt and a conversion from
Francesca Basile in the first half and trailed by just three at the break, 10-7. Harvard scored 36 in the second half to come away with the 46-7 victory.
COLBY-SAWYER vs. QUINNIPIAC - L, 0-51
COLBY-SAWYER vs. SACRED HEART - W, 20-14
Colby-Sawyer held a 10-7 lead at the half and each team would double its score in the second to make the final, 20-14, in favor of the Chargers.
Bailey Burt,
Jess Burt,
Jordyn Enos and
Madison Rettenmaier each contributed a try in the win.
COLBY-SAWYER vs. MOLLOY - L, 19-22
The Chargers ended the day in with a close match against Molloy.
Jordyn Enos,
Jess Burt and
Bailey Burt registered tries, while
Francesca Basile finished with a pair of conversions. The Lions were able to escape with a 22-19 win.
